+// RUN: %clangxx_asan -O2 %s -o %t
+// RUN: %t 2>&1 | FileCheck %s
+#include <stdlib.h>
+#include <unistd.h>
+
+extern "C" {
+bool __asan_get_ownership(const void *p);
+
+void *global_ptr;
+
+// Note: avoid calling functions that allocate memory in malloc/free
+// to avoid infinite recursion.
+void __asan_malloc_hook(void *ptr, size_t sz) {
+ if (__asan_get_ownership(ptr)) {
+ write(1, "MallocHook\n", sizeof("MallocHook\n"));
+ global_ptr = ptr;
+ }
+}
+void __asan_free_hook(void *ptr) {
+ if (__asan_get_ownership(ptr) && ptr == global_ptr)
+ write(1, "FreeHook\n", sizeof("FreeHook\n"));
+}
+} // extern "C"
+
+int main() {
+ volatile int *x = new int;
+ // CHECK: MallocHook
+ // Check that malloc hook was called with correct argument.
+ if (global_ptr != (void*)x) {
+ _exit(1);
+ }
+ *x = 0;
+ delete x;
+ // CHECK: FreeHook
+ return 0;
+}
